w00t, CRYSIS 2 multiplayer demo is out! Just downloaded it on Steam and played for an hour, the first thing i noticed was how i got my ass handed to me... well, i played with an Xbox360 controller in front of my tv, so it’s noone’s fault but my own... but i basically just wanted to see how it runs, looks, feels, and as i already was sitting comfy on my couch...
So how does it run? There are only three basic graphics quality settings to choose from, without fancy knobs and tweaks like we PC gamers are used to: “Gamer”, “Advanced” and “Hardcore”. I took no prisoners, set it to the latter and the resolution to Full HD. Have to say, runs quite smoothly on my 2 year old machine and looks very pretty! Seems the CryEngine 3 is doing a damn good job, just like CRYTEK promised it would.
Of course, there was no time to really enjoy the scenery, but from what i could see, besides the floor, everything is very shiny, feels nice and polished. Just what you would expect from CRYTEK.
Also, i like how you can, and have to, access the nano suit for extra powers. You can activate armor, cloak yourself and use several different types of vision. As we know from CRYSIS (1), the amount of power used for this is limited, so same here. Cloak vanishes quite rapidly, while the armor stays on you a while.... on others as well, of course...
In the beginning it felt a bit overwhelming, getting used to the controls and the maps (there’s two of them in the demo), i would always forget to use the powers and die instantly. So i guess you really have to learn to utilize them cleverly to succeed, might actually not be an overstatement when they say “it’s a gamechanger”... like in the well made intro movie, which explains how it works in an entertaining way.
